
Redevelopment begins at Port Macquarie Private Hospital
It is expected to be completed by April 2026.
Construction has begun on the $6.4m (A$10m) redevelopment of Port Macquarie Private Hospital in Australia.
Stage one of the project includes the addition of a seventh operating theatre, the introduction of onsite radiology, and upgrades to 12 patient rooms, said Port Macquarie Private Hospital CEO, Moira Finch.
“A new main reception area, expanded day surgery admission area, and additional parking will improve the hospital experience for patients and visitors alike,” Finch added.
The project will also feature a new central sterilising area.
The redevelopment is expected to be completed by April 2026.
